https://yq.aliyun.com/ziliao/210955 输出结果: 第一种方法耗时:101918微秒第二种方法耗时:49042微秒第三种方法耗时:82706微秒第四种方法耗时:75093微秒 把上述的1000000改成10,输出结果如下: 第一种方法耗时 ...
测试环境:jdk . . Processor . GHz Intel Core i 遍历Map的方式有很多,通常场景下我们需要的是遍历Map中的Key和Value。 更新:增加一个方法对方法一优化,采用foreach循环 写了四个方法: while循环 map.entrySet .iterator 获取map的value param map public static void getMap Ma ...
2017-02-19 15:18 0 4698 推荐指数:
https://yq.aliyun.com/ziliao/210955 输出结果: 第一种方法耗时:101918微秒第二种方法耗时:49042微秒第三种方法耗时:82706微秒第四种方法耗时:75093微秒 把上述的1000000改成10,输出结果如下: 第一种方法耗时 ...
HashMap有几种遍历方法 HashMap 的遍历方法有很多种,不同的 JDK 版本有不同的写法,其中 JDK 8 就提供了 3 种 HashMap 的遍历方法,并且一举打破了之前遍历方法“很臃肿”的尴尬。 7 种 HashMap 的遍历方式,其中 JDK 8 之前主要使用 EntrySet ...
; import java.util.Set; //循环遍历map的方法 pub ...
HashMap的几种遍历方法 1、第一种: 2、第二种: 3、第三种: ...
遍历 HashMap ...
https://stackoverflow.com/questions/46898/how-do-i-efficiently-iterate-over-each-entry-in-a-java-map ...
当需要对元素进行计数时,HashMap非常有用,如下例子,统计一个字符串中每个字符出现的次数: 输出结果: g 2b 3c 3a 3k 1h 1 HashMap遍历 打印HashMap的元素 根据键值对的value排序 以下代码往TreeMap ...
看了一篇博客,挺有意思,OC各种遍历方法的效率,打算自己也测试一番。看看,究竟哪一个的效率更好一些! 准备工作:懒加载一个数组,创建一千万个对象添加到数组。 1.测试普通 for 循环 控制台输出: 我晕,我这里耗时相差了 7.684s ...